Property Insights of Z-Asp(NH2)-Cys(CH2-Ph)-OMe

The XLogP value of 1.8 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Z-Asp(NH2)-Cys(CH2-Ph)-OMe. The TPSA of 162.0 Ų indicates high polarity, suggesting Z-Asp(NH2)-Cys(CH2-Ph)-OMe may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, Z-Asp(NH2)-Cys(CH2-Ph)-OMe has 3 hydrogen bond donor(s) and 7 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
